云服务器时间不同步可能会对服务器上运行的应用和服务产生影响,导致数据不一致、日志混乱等问题。以下是云服务器时间不同步的原因、影响以及相应的解决方法:
云服务器时间不同步的原因
- 时区设置不正确:服务器和系统配置的时区不一致,导致系统显示的时间与实际时间存在误差。
- 硬件时钟问题:服务器硬件本身出现故障或损坏,如电池电量不足或时钟芯片损坏,导致服务器时间和系统时间不一致。
- 网络同步问题:服务器与时间服务器的通信异常,导致无法对服务器时间和系统时间进行同步,可能是由于网络延迟或网络连接不稳定。
- 操作系统或软件问题:操作系统的时间设置可能出现问题,例如时区设置不正确,或者时钟同步机制配置错误,同时一些软件应用程序可能会对服务器的时间进行修改或调整。
云服务器时间不同步的影响
- 数据一致性:可能导致数据的时间戳错误,使得数据无法正确地进行同步。
- 日志分析和故障排查:准确的时间戳对于日志分析和故障排查至关重要,时间不同步可能导致日志中的时间戳错误,使得对问题的定位和分析变得困难。
- 安全认证:时间同步对于安全认证也是很重要的,时间不同步可能导致安全认证失败,从而影响系统的安全性。
- 分布式系统协调:在分布式系统中,时间不同步可能导致分布式系统出现一致性问题和通信错误。
解决云服务器时间不同步的方法
- 修改时区设置:通过修改操作系统的时区设置来调整服务器的时间。
- 同步系统时间:使用NTP服务或手动同步方法来校准时间,如使用
ntpdate
命令或date
命令手动设置时间。 - 配置时钟同步服务:确保服务器上的时钟同步服务(如NTP)配置正确,可以设置自动同步时间,确保系统时间与网络时间保持一致。
- 检查网络连接:确保服务器可以与时间服务器进行通信,检查网络防火墙设置,确保时间服务器的访问不会被阻止。
- 更新系统软件:确保服务器上安装的系统软件是最新的版本,包括时间同步服务,以避免由于软件问题导致的时间不同步。
通过上述方法,可以有效解决云服务器时间不同步的问题,确保服务器时间的准确性和系统的稳定运行。